Quote:
Originally Posted by ps3veron
In your opinion, how does it compare to last year's game?

Do you think its worth the purchase for a casual nascar fan?

Finally, can you start on the grid or is it like last year's game whereby engines are already running.
I'm going to answer the questions in reverse order. Unfortunately, no the cars come off turns 4 under computer control at the start of the race.

I think it's worth the purchase for a casual NASCAR fan. It's a fun game and a realistic game but I would not fit this into a simulation category. I'm curious what is in this day 1 patch. This game isn't horrible out of the box. It could definitely use some tweaks though.

I feel it's better than last year's game. I bought last year's game on day 1. The presentation is much better. The format of the racing season makes this an instant upgrade. You have plenty of practice time to tweak the setup. The A.I. driving is better. Literally these drivers drive like themselves. If you are about to lap a driver like Tony Stewart or Kyle Busch be ready for a fight. Juan Pablo Montoya is unpredictable with his lines. Mark Martin and I can point out small things that are either in the game or missing. Fox Sports is in the game and Darrell Waltrip says that famous tagline before races. There is a career mode which is actually has pretty good depth. Ray Evernham really does a solid job in this game. I haven't started a season with a NASCAR driver yet.

I've been mainly playing with the controller. I haven't gotten to play this game a ton with my G27 wheel. Quote:
Originally Posted by ps3veron
Awesome! Thanks for your time dmoney.

Last question: hows the damage? I remember last year's game you would slam into a wall at 150 and
walk away with a little dent! Has this been fixed?

Keep them impressions coming!
The damage model is really good. The cars sheet metal bends rather than tear like last year. You will still some tears of the sheet metal. If you hit the wall head on at 150 the car will probably DNF.
